Output 8fc57b896e24eb422291aae26b86d2b8c971d61a12b268852a65f9300c19fb09:27

value
53698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0a44b2cf0111883b57ded8a99b4147bc091941a OP_EQUALVERIFY OP_CHECKSIG
address
1L2CNDzQinD31vKn8pHCh9sKkGUb86xnp7
transaction
8fc57b896e24eb422291aae26b86d2b8c971d61a12b268852a65f9300c19fb09
spent
true